您当前的位置:首页 > 常见问答

数据库中的两个点代表什么含义

发布时间:2025-03-06 01:57:25    发布人:远客网络

数据库中的“点点”通常指的是两个连续的“..”符号,也被称为省略号。在数据库中,这个符号有两种常见的含义。

  1. 在SQL查询中使用点点表示范围选择。例如,可以使用点点选择一个表中的一系列连续的行,或者选择一个表中的一系列连续的列。例如,SELECT * FROM table_name WHERE column_name BETWEEN value1 AND value2 表示选择表中指定列名的数据在指定的value1和value2之间的所有行。

  2. 在数据库模型设计中使用点点表示实体间的关系。在关系数据库中,实体之间的关系可以通过外键来建立。当一个实体与另一个实体存在一对多或多对多的关系时,通常会使用点点来表示这种关系。例如,在一个学生和课程的关系中,一个学生可以选择多门课程,而一门课程也可以有多个学生选择,这种关系可以用点点来表示。

除了以上两种常见的含义,数据库中的点点还可以用于其他一些特定的场景,如表示模糊查询中的通配符或表示连接操作中的表别名等。在具体的数据库操作中,根据上下文的不同,点点的含义可能会有所不同。因此,在使用点点时,需要根据具体的情况来理解其含义。

在数据库中,"点"通常指的是数据表中的字段(column),也叫做属性(attribute)。而"点点"则表示两个字段之间的关系,通常用于表示表与表之间的连接(join)操作。

在关系型数据库中,数据被组织成表(table),每个表由一系列的字段(列)组成,而每一行则代表一个记录。通过连接操作,我们可以将两个或多个表中的数据进行关联,以实现更复杂的查询。

连接操作可以通过两个或多个表之间的共同字段来实现。例如,我们有一个学生表(student)和一个课程表(course),这两个表可以通过学生的学号(student_id)字段进行连接。通过连接操作,我们可以查询某个学生所选的所有课程,或者查询某门课程的所有学生。

常见的连接操作有内连接(inner join)、左连接(left join)、右连接(right join)和全连接(full join)。内连接返回两个表中共有的数据行,左连接返回左表中所有的数据行和右表中共有的数据行,右连接则返回右表中所有的数据行和左表中共有的数据行,而全连接则返回两个表中所有的数据行。

通过连接操作,我们可以实现数据的关联和分析,从而得到更加全面和准确的结果。这是数据库中非常重要的一个概念和操作,对于数据分析和处理具有重要的意义。

数据库中的两个点点通常指的是连接符号".."。在数据库中,两个点点的含义和作用有以下几个方面。

  1. 表示表名和字段名的层级关系:在数据库中,表名和字段名通常按照层级关系进行命名。使用两个点点可以表示表名和字段名之间的层级关系,方便进行数据查询和操作。例如,"表名.字段名"表示从某个表中查询某个字段的值。

  2. 表示范围查询:在某些查询语言中,两个点点可以表示范围查询。例如,在SQL语句中,可以使用"字段名 BETWEEN 值1 AND 值2"来表示某个字段的取值范围。

  3. 表示引用外部库或模块:在一些编程语言中,使用两个点点可以表示引用外部库或模块。例如,在Python中,可以使用"模块名.函数名"的方式来调用其他模块中的函数。

  4. 表示路径分隔符:在一些操作系统中,两个点点可以表示路径的分隔符。例如,在Windows系统中,路径可以使用"目录名子目录名文件名"的方式表示,其中两个点点表示路径的层级关系。

需要注意的是,不同的数据库和编程语言对两个点点的使用可能会有所差异,具体的使用方式需要根据实际情况进行判断和理解。